PH, Malaysian foreign ministers meet ahead of PM Anwar Ibrahim’s official visit

MANILA, Philippines – Foreign Affairs Secretary Enrique Manalo and Malaysian Foreign Minister Dato’ Seri Diraja Dr. Zambry Abd Kadir met on Tuesday, ahead of the official visit of Malaysian prime minister Anwar Ibrahim to the Philippines on Wednesday.

In a statement, the Department of Foreign Affairs (DFA) said that the two leaders had an introductory courtesy call and were pleased to note that their bilateral trade remained strong despite the COVID-19 pandemic.

“Malaysia continues to be one of the Philippines’ top trade partners. I look forward to working closely with Malaysia to intensify economic ties, as well as tourism exchanges, in this period of post-pandemic recovery,” Manalo was quoted as saying.

Both countries hoped to bolster security cooperation and promote peace and stability in Southeast Asia.

The two officials also tackled regional and international issues of mutual concern.

“Both sides looked forward to the reconvening of the Joint Commission Meeting to build on existing and explore new areas of cooperation, and to the official visit of Malaysian Prime Minister Anwar [Ibrahim] as an impetus to reinvigorate bilateral ties,” the DFA said.
